LIMA: Peru central bank bought $109 million in the local spot market on Thursday as the sol strengthened 0.25 percent to end bidding 3.209 per dollar, tracking demand for emerging market assets and minerals that Peru exports.
A calmer political outlook after President Pedro Pablo Kuczynski narrowly survived an impeachment bid last month has also helped the sol, traders said.
